Understanding the Core Principles of Slot Allocation

Slot allocation, at its heart, is about managing capacity. It’s about acknowledging that resources—time, personnel, equipment, infrastructure—are finite, and that these resources need to be strategically assigned to maximize output and minimize waste. A primary driver for implementing robust slot allocation is to avoid overcommitment. When resources are consistently stretched thin, the quality of work suffers, deadlines are missed, and employee morale declines. Effective slotting allows for a buffer, a safeguard against unforeseen circumstances, and promotes a more sustainable pace of operation. This isn’t simply about doing more; it’s about doing the right things, at the right time, with the right resources.

The Role of Forecasting and Demand Analysis

Central to successful slot allocation is a comprehensive understanding of future demand. Accurate forecasting is no longer a ‘nice-to-have’ but a critical necessity. Organizations must move beyond reactive responses to anticipated needs. This involves utilizing historical data, analyzing market trends, and incorporating insights from various departments to predict future workloads. Sophisticated software solutions and data analytics tools can play a pivotal role in this process, providing data-driven insights that inform slotting decisions. Ignoring the forecasting aspect can lead to situations where slots are underutilized during low demand and completely overwhelmed during peak periods, nullifying the benefits of allocation altogether.

Resource Type Allocation Metric Forecasting Horizon Review Frequency
Human Capital Hours per week / Project Tasks 1-3 months Weekly
Server Capacity CPU Usage / Storage Space 3-6 months Monthly
Meeting Rooms Number of Bookings / Duration 1 week Daily
Manufacturing Equipment Production Cycles / Downtime 1-6 months Weekly

As demonstrated in the table above, the specific metrics and forecasting horizons will vary depending on the resource being allocated. A consistent review process ensures allocations remain aligned with real-time conditions and future projections. The key takeaway is that allocation shouldn’t be a static exercise but an adaptive, ongoing process.

Implementing Slotting in Diverse Operational Contexts

The application of slot allocation principles isn’t limited to a single industry or department. It’s a versatile methodology that can be adapted to suit a wide range of operational contexts. In a customer service center, for example, slots can be assigned for handling different types of inquiries—technical support, billing questions, sales requests—ensuring that specialized agents are available when and where they are needed most. In a software development setting, slots can be dedicated to coding, testing, debugging, and documentation, promoting a structured and efficient development lifecycle. The flexibility of this approach is one of its greatest strengths.

The Benefits of Prioritization Within Slot Allocation

Simply creating slots is not enough. Effective slot allocation must be coupled with a robust prioritization framework. Not all tasks are created equal, and resources should be allocated accordingly. Techniques such as the Eisenhower Matrix (urgent/important) or weighted scoring systems can help organizations identify and prioritize tasks that deliver the highest value. By focusing on high-priority items within allocated slots, organizations can maximize their return on investment and achieve the most significant impact. This helps to minimize the potential for lower-value tasks to consume valuable resources, leading to diminished overall productivity.

  • Improved Resource Utilization: Minimizes idle time and maximizes the productive capacity of available resources.
  • Reduced Bottlenecks: Prevents overburdening specific areas or personnel, ensuring a smoother workflow.
  • Enhanced Predictability: Provides a clear schedule of activities, making it easier to anticipate and manage potential challenges.
  • Increased Customer Satisfaction: Faster turnaround times and dedicated support contribute to a better customer experience.
  • Better Project Management: Improved task assignment and scheduling improves overall project delivery.

These benefits highlight why adopting a structured approach to resource allocation is so essential for organizations aiming for operational excellence. The implementation of well-defined slots, coupled with prioritization, significantly boosts overall functional output.

Technology's Role in Streamlined Slot Management

While manual slot allocation is feasible for small organizations with limited complexity, it quickly becomes unwieldy as operations scale. Technology plays a crucial role in automating and streamlining the slot management process. Dedicated scheduling software, resource management platforms, and even enterprise resource planning (ERP) systems offer a range of features designed to facilitate efficient allocation. These tools can automate task assignment, track resource availability, generate reports, and provide real-time insights into resource utilization. Investing in the right technology can significantly reduce administrative overhead and improve accuracy.

Integrating Slotting with Existing Systems

To maximize the benefits of technology, it’s essential to integrate slot management tools with existing systems. For example, integrating a scheduling system with a customer relationship management (CRM) platform can ensure that customer support agents are automatically assigned slots based on their skills and availability. Similarly, integrating with project management software can streamline task assignment and track progress against deadlines. Seamless integration eliminates data silos, reduces manual data entry, and provides a holistic view of resource allocation across the organization. This interconnectedness is crucial for fostering collaboration and maximizing efficiency.

  1. Assess Current Workflows: Understand the current method of resource allocation and identify pain points.
  2. Select Appropriate Software: Choose a platform that aligns with specific needs and budget.
  3. Integrate with Existing Systems: Connect the slotting tool with CRM, ERP, and project management platforms.
  4. Train Users: Provide comprehensive training to ensure staff are proficient in using the new system.
  5. Monitor and Optimize: Continuously monitor resource utilization and adjust allocations as needed.

Following these steps is crucial for successful implementation and realizing the full potential of technology-enabled slot management. Consistent monitoring and adaptation are key to maintaining optimal performance.

Addressing Challenges in Slot Allocation

Implementing a slot allocation system isn’t without its challenges. One common obstacle is resistance to change. Employees may be accustomed to a more ad-hoc approach and may view a structured system as restrictive. Effective communication and change management are essential to overcome this resistance. Transparency about the benefits of slot allocation and involving employees in the implementation process can foster buy-in. Another challenge is ensuring that slots are flexible enough to accommodate unexpected events or changing priorities. Rigid schedules can stifle innovation and prevent organizations from responding effectively to dynamic market conditions. It’s important to build in buffers and allow for some degree of adaptability.
